Output 59a8150fecd1e4114d660def8995df3cfa959f56d64975f50a7a0965dc8ffcff:19

value
346649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ce5c1ffb6cc1c55ee88d0f09d058831e1945082 OP_EQUAL
address
38hcWyWxievYPnwQSNAzaDPywj9U1boMSv
transaction
59a8150fecd1e4114d660def8995df3cfa959f56d64975f50a7a0965dc8ffcff
spent
true